I am trying to use Func with Async Method. And I am getting an error.
Cannot convert async lambda expression to delegate type
'Func<HttpResponseMesage>'
. An async lambda expression may return void, Task orTask<T>
, none of which are convertible to'Func<HttpResponseMesage>'
.
below is my Code:
public async Task<HttpResponseMessage> CallAsyncMethod()
{
Console.WriteLine("Calling Youtube");
HttpClient client = new HttpClient();
var response = await client.GetAsync("https://www.youtube.com/watch?v=_OBlgSz8sSM");
Console.WriteLine("Got Response from youtube");
return response;
}
static void Main(string[] args)
{
Program p = new Program();
Task<HttpResponseMessage> myTask = p.CallAsyncMethod();
Func<HttpResponseMessage> myFun =async () => await myTask;
Console.ReadLine();
}
The path I usually take is to have the
Main
method invoke aRun()
method that returns a Task, and.Wait()
on theTask
to complete.This allows the rest of your Console app to run with full async/await support. Since there isn't any UI thread in a console app, you don't run the risk of deadlocking with the usage of
.Wait()
.As the error says, async methods return
Task
,Task<T>
orvoid
. So to get this to work you can:Code fix such as:
